The STSPIN233 device integrates a triple half-bridge low RDS(ON) power stage in a small VFQFPN 3 x 3 x 1.0 mm package ideal for small and space constrained applications. The device is designed to operate in battery-powered scenarios and can be forced in a zero consumption state, allowing a significant increase in battery life. The STSPIN233 is supporting three shunt sensing topology. The device offers a complete set of protection including overcurrent, overtemperature and short-circuit protection.
Operating voltage from 1.8 to 10 V Maximum output current 1.3 Arms RDS(ON) HS + LS = 0.4 Ω typ. Full protection set Non-dissipative overcurrent protection Short-circuit protection Thermal shutdown Supporting three shunt sensing topology Direct driving, dedicated input and enable pin for each half-bridge Energy saving and long battery life with standby consumption less than 80 nA
